Original Description
Jan Brueghel the Elder's A Landscape with Travellers on the Outskirts of a Riverside Village is a captivating Flemish Baroque masterpiece that exemplifies the artist’s exceptional skill in rendering idyllic natural scenes. Painted in the early 17th century, the work depicts a serene countryside inhabited by travellers, peasants, and animals, all framed by a gently flowing river and lush foliage. Brueghel’s meticulous attention to detail—seen in the delicate foliage, the subtle play of light, and the rich textures—creates a harmonious and immersive pastoral world. The painting reflects the Northern Renaissance tradition of landscape painting, where nature becomes a narrative setting rather than merely a backdrop. As a leading figure of the Brueghel dynasty, Jan the Elder played a pivotal role in elevating landscape painting to an independent genre, influencing later artists like Rubens, with whom he frequently collaborated. This work, with its refined composition and atmospheric depth, remains a significant testament to his contribution to European art history.
